It’s important that the business arrangement between a manager and their client (artist, musician, songwriter, producer, engineer, etc) be put into writing and signed by both parties in the form of an artist management contract or music manager agreement.
Even though disasters cannot always be avoided, obligations can be made much clearer and responsibilities more easily understood with the presence of a written artist management agreement. Before you get an attorney to draft a contract for you, however, you should first take stock of what you are prepared to do with and for an artist and what you expect out of the relationship.

For-profit and non-profit businesses are required to obtain licenses for various business activities in Montgomery County. The sale of alcohol (i.e., restaurants, stores, hotels, catering, beer and wine sampling tasting, wine corkage, outdoor café, extended holiday hours, one day special events, and festivals).

Businesses selling tangible personal property or taxable services will need to obtain a sales and use tax permit from the Texas Comptroller of Public Accounts. Businesses may also have to register with the Secretary of State and file an annual franchise tax report.

TYPES OF REQUIRED PERMITS: Building - New Commercial or Residential buildings, additions, alterations, or moving (such as a manufactured home). New Occupancy in a commercial building. Swimming pool installations. Irrigation systems.

General Business License All entities that transact business in Texas are required to register with the Texas Secretary of State or county clerk's office.

You might also be wondering, “How long can you operate a business without a license?” Judging by real-world examples, you could be shut down in as little as 60 days. In one instance, a legal entity missed the renewal notice for a seemingly minor business license.

A general business license is not required in Texas.
